Blockbuster new set-top box
Posted on November 29th, 2008 by freedvdtrials.com
Blockbuster would roll out a new digital media player that brings fewer, but more recent titles from the Internet to consumers’ televisions than a six-month old offering from rival Netflix. The MediaPoint player by broadband device maker 2Wire allows Blockbuster customers to download high-definition quality movies to their TVs via broadband lines for $1.99 apiece, after an initial $99 for the box and 25 films.
